  1. if a parabola has its vertex at ( x = 5 ) and opens upward, which of the following correctly describes its increasing interval? a. ( (5,infty) ) b. ( (0,5) ) c. ( (-infty,5) ) d. ( (-infty,0) )

Explanation:

Step1: Recall the properties of a parabola

For a parabola \(y = a(x - h)^2 + k\) (vertex form), if \(a>0\) (opens upward), the vertex is \((h,k)\). The function is decreasing on the interval \((-\infty,h)\) and increasing on the interval \((h,\infty)\).

Step2: Identify \(h\) value

Given the vertex \(x = 5\), so \(h = 5\). Since the parabola opens upward (\(a>0\)), the increasing interval is \((5,\infty)\).

Answer:

A. \((5,\infty)\)
